Students' Guild appoints new chief executive

The Students’ Guild is delighted to announce that Tracy Costello has been appointed as our new Chief Executive.

The decision to appoint Tracy follows a rigorous application and interview process. We were fortunate to have a strong field of candidates and are excited to welcome Tracy to the role.

Tracy joined the Students’ Guild in 2005 from Littlewoods Retail, taking up the newly created post of Commercial Development Manager. Responsible for overseeing the Guild’s trading outlets, Tracy quickly implemented a number of strategic changes that transformed the service delivery of the outlets and boosted customer service to students.

In 2007 Tracy undertook the role of Acting General Manager, assuming oversight of Guild operations. In this post, Tracy guided the Guild through a period of turbulence and financial instability whilst delivering against strategic priorities and objectives and increasing student engagement.

In 2008 Tracy was appointed to the role of Deputy Chief Executive which included leadership of the Business & Enterprise directorate. Whilst supporting the Chief Executive in leading the Students’ Guild, Tracy also managed many of the Guild’s central services including Finance, Personnel, IT, administration, IGNITE, company compliance and, until 2013, Communications & Marketing. In this complex role, Tracy was a key figure in stabilising and developing the Guild, establishing a strong position for the future. Cost reduction programmes and quality enhancement initiatives such as the Student Union Evaluation Initiative are just two examples of schemes introduced under Tracy’s tenure that have ensured the continued growth of the Guild.

Since September 2013 Tracy has been in post as Interim Chief Executive, ensuring a seamless transition during the departure of the outgoing Chief Executive and continuity of service provision. In her short time as Interim CE, Tracy led an action group to ensure the provision of an outstanding Freshers’ experience to every student in the context of a sharp rise in student numbers and has, most recently, implemented the Pop-up Guild in X-Keys, bringing Guild services directly to students at the St. Luke’s campus.
